2006 Chrysler 300 vs. 2005 Infiniti M

To start off, 2006 Chrysler 300 is newer by 1 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2005 Infiniti M.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2005 Infiniti M would be higher. At 4,494 cc (8 cylinders), 2005 Infiniti M is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2005 Infiniti M (335 HP @ 6400 RPM) has 88 more horse power than 2006 Chrysler 300. (247 HP @ 6400 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2005 Infiniti M should accelerate faster than 2006 Chrysler 300.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2006 Chrysler 300 weights approximately 83 kg more than 2005 Infiniti M.

Because 2006 Chrysler 300 is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2005 Infiniti M.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2006 Chrysler 300 will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2005 Infiniti M (461 Nm @ 4000 RPM) has 121 more torque (in Nm) than 2006 Chrysler 300. (340 Nm @ 3800 RPM). This means 2005 Infiniti M will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2006 Chrysler 300.
